Extracted from Magmug:

Armed with a mission to bring about the hardstyle dance scene in Asia, DJ Zilch from Sydney and DJ Formica from Singapore made stunning appearances in Singapore’s first hard-dance shuffle event: Our very own Magmug’s Hardstyle Climax. The fantastic duo brought Snow City down with the hard trance, hardstyle, electro and techno, providing the music for the very enthusiastic local shuffling crews all night.

DJ Zilch started off as a young man fascinated with the world of electronic dance music in Sydney. In 2004, he bought a pair of turntables and some vinyls and learnt to mix on his own, before crafting mixtape CDs and posting them online. It wasn’t before long till his mix tapes got noticed and became a hit in the Sydney scene and internet forums. He was then offered to spin at various clubs and events. That was how it all started, the craze for electronic dance music. Hitting it off well with the dance scene music in Sydney between 2004-2009, DJ Zilch played and became a resident DJ at every major trance clubs and events, such as Energy, Daydreams, Basscode, Wanted, A Night Of Trance, shuffle.com parties, and electro clubs.

DJ Zilch

In 2008, Zilch was featured on Sydney’s Beatz FM radio and became a special guest DJ in Brisbane’s AussieHardstyle.com official launch party. His achievements have set him out to be well known all over Australia and Singapore. Zilch’s biggest performance yet would be playing to a crowd of 1,000 people in the club! The experience was crazy where the crowd went mad, portraying a truly ecstatic scene. Commenting that the shufflers community in Sydney was way better known, DJ Zilch was pleased that the hard-dance shuffle scene in Singapore is slowly growing, and is more than glad to be providing the music for it. So, if you ever hear of a hard-dance music event, be sure to look out for the up and coming DJ Zilch, who has temporarily relocated to Singapore as of 2009.

Moving on, DJ Formica has been in the scene for 30 months. Unlike DJ Zilch, Formica took a quieter and simple approach to the hard-dance scene in Singapore by choosing the route of being a freelance DJ. He often organized his own parties and performed at Home club on Tuesday nights. Hardstyle and electro music was his forte. Being a shuffler himself before, he better understands how his audience would like the music played depending on speed and type of rhythm. The story for DJ Formica all started out in 2006, where he was greatly exposed to the shuffling scene in Melbourne, and drew his interest from there. DJ Formica sets a main aim of spinning in Singapore, where he wants to promote a “clean” hard-dance scene for talented youngsters in Singapore.

DJ Formica

Both these DJs have become known for their own style of hard-dance music in Singapore. DJ Zilch, and our very own home-grown, DJ Formica, we salute you.

Sir Bobby Robson: 1933-2009

Ex-England manager Sir Bobby Robson has died at the age of 76. He led his country to two World Cup finals, in 1986 and 1990, and took Newcastle United into the Champions League as recently as 2003. He passed away on Friday morning, after a long battle with cancer.
